Transaction 22c33b488ab61393ed487dbdd5bce09ecdcf2eeff2dd48a79218189dfa3bbf0a
1 Input
1 Output
-
22c33b488ab61393ed487dbdd5bce09ecdcf2eeff2dd48a79218189dfa3bbf0a:0
- value
- 542795
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03d86de99035910bc39e954af14eaffd5cb90c83 OP_EQUAL
- address
- 323MDtnuzH7NyzfedCHjjUCdptrTq75cDT